What is multi-criteria analysis?

A Multi-Criteria Analysis (MCA) can be used to identify and compare different policy options by assessing their effects, performance, impacts, and trade-offs. MCA provides a systematic approach for supporting complex decisions according to pre-determined criteria and objectives.

How do you do multiple criteria decision analysis?

Multi-criteria decision-making in general follows six steps including, (1) problem formulation, (2) identify the requirements, (3) set goals, (4) identify various alternatives, (5) develop criteria, and (6) identify and apply decision-making technique (Sabaei, Erkoyuncu, & Roy, 2015).

What is multi-criteria analysis in GIS?

Multi-criteria analysis (MCA) is a technique used to consider many different criteria when making a decision. MCA gives a logical, well-structured process to follow so different factors can be clearly identified and prioritised. It allows the alternative solutions being considered to be ranked in order of suitability.

Is multi-criteria analysis qualitative?

Because MCA is able to consider both qualitative and quantitative information, it is especially applicable in scenarios where such a combination of factors must be considered in the ranking of adaptation interventions.

What is spatial multi criteria decision analysis?

Spatial Multi-Criteria Decision Analysis (MCDA) supports decision making and site selection in the sense that it sets the framework for evaluating alternatives on the basis of multiple evaluation criteria.

What is spatial multi criteria evaluation?

Spatial multi-criteria evaluation (SMCE) is a technique that assists stakeholders make decisions with respect to a particular goal (in this case landslide susceptibility). The input is a set of maps that are spatial representations of the criteria, which are grouped, standardized, and weighted in a criteria tree.

What is Multi Attribute decision-making?

Multiple Attribute Decision Making (MADM) involves “making preference decisions (such as evaluation, prioritization, selection) over the available alternatives that are characterized by multiple, usually conflicting, attributes”. The problems of MADM are diverse, and can be found in virtually any topic.
